Duane “Keefe D” Davis will nonetheless pursue the likelihood to get out of jail on bond as he awaits trial within the killing of 2Pac. His lawyer, Carl Arnold, confirmed the choice to Newsweek after a Nevada decide denied his newest try at posting bond. He wants $750,000 to take action and had a deal lined up with Wack 100 to get it performed, however the decide discovered the supply of the cash suspicious.
“We’re disillusioned with the court docket’s resolution to disclaim bail to Mr. Davis, particularly contemplating the thorough vetting by Konvict Bail Bonds of the funding supply performed earlier than the supply listening to,” Arnold mentioned. “We firmly imagine there’s a lack of substantive proof that Mr. Davis supposed to revenue from his alleged connections to the case.”

Calling into the courtroom by way of Zoom, Wack claimed the funds got here from his enterprise, 100 Leisure. “I do know him from passing. I do know his son. We sat down and talked a number of occasions typically about private issues when he was having his bout with most cancers. Private issues, trade stuff. Simply common dialog,” Wack mentioned. “He is at all times been a monumental man in our group. And I’ve helped a number of individuals in our group, whether or not it was funerals, whether or not it was for bail.” He additionally promised solely to interview him as soon as the trial was over.
